Question 333604: part a-solve for V: D=m over V
part b- find the volume V of a sample if its density is 4.5 g/cm^3 and its mass is 36.0g. Carry along the units in your calculation to obtain the proper units in your answer.

part a: -solve for V: D=m over V
D = m%2Fv
Multiply both sides by v, results
Dv = m
Divide both sides by D, results
v = m%2FD
:
:
part b:- find the volume V of a sample if its density is 4.5 g/cm^3 and its mass is 36.0g.
v = m%2FD
Replace m and D with the given values:
v = 36%2F4.5
v = 8 cu/cm is the volume
